How formal are the formal nights? My parents have a matching Hawaiian shirt & long dress. Is that acceptable or do they need to wear the dark suite & formal dress? They have beautiful matching outfits & for obvious reasons don’t get to wear them too often……. Or is that something they can wear anytime?

They were pretty formal, suits, tuxes, cocktail length and long dresses. They could wear that outfit on tropical night... there were lots of hawaiian outfits on that night

I purchased a dress in Tahiti the 1st time I was on the Tahitian. I wore that dress (which was a floor length sun dress) for our formal night on our second Tahitian cruise. I think if your father wore his shirt with a nice pair of slacks and dress shoes this would be acceptable. There is a wide variety of formal wear on the Tahitian. As kiberkid has posted they can always wear those outfits for tropical night.
